T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Indonesia's Religious Affairs Ministry announced that the first day of Syawwal 1442 H, or the Eid al-Fitr day, falls on Thursday, May 13, 2021. This result was obtained in the Isbat meeting held in 88 spots across the country on Tuesday, May 11.

The Religious Affairs Minister Yaqut Cholil Qoumas said the decision was made in the Isbat meeting as "the hilal (moon) wasn't visible," he said on Tuesday. Therefore, the first day of Syawwal or Eid al-Fitr celebration falls on Thursday, May 13.

Indonesian astronomy expert from the Hijri Calendar Unification Team of religious Affairs Ministry, Cecep Nurwendaya, that there was no empirical reference for hilal visibility for the first day of Syawal 1442 H across Indonesian regions on Tuesday, May 11, 2021.

Cecep conveyed it when explaining the data of moon (hilal) position to determine the first day of Syawwal 1442 Islamic year (Hijri) during the isbat meeting at the Religious Affairs Ministry office in Jakarta.

“The hilal altitude is negative in all of Indonesian regions at around -5.6 until -4.4 degrees. The moon sets first before the sun," he said in a written statement on Tuesday, May 11, 2021.

The determination of the first day of Hijri month is based on rukyat and hisab. The hisab process had been done and the result is available.

Based on hisab calculation system, the first day of Syawwal month falls on Thursday, May 13, 2021. This data, he said, was informative, while the confirmation awaits the result of the Isbat meeting.

Cecep explained that rukyat is an astronomical observation and therefore, there should be a reference. He went on to say that if there is the reference, then it can be accepted, and vice versa.
